Web10 de nov. de 2024 · Once boiling, add the cranberries, cinnamon, nutmeg and chopped apples. Return to a boil (this should take about 2 minutes) and then simmer on medium low heat until most of the cranberries have popped (about 5 minutes). Once the cranberries have popped, add the clementine, brown sugar and walnuts. Cook for another 5 minutes.
